Social Care Consultations Are Ongoing

The engagement programme to develop detailed plans for social care reform are continuing as Department of Health and Social Care officials met with a range of social care organisations in a new Health and Wellbeing Alliance Social Care group.

Made up of a wide range of voluntary and charitable organisations, the group discussed the vision for social care.

The DHSC is also working with system leaders, voluntary organisations and charities to discuss how system-wide social care reform can best support care users.
